Alright guys I'm getting ready to buy my new exhaust system abd was wondering what everyone was getting in the terms of price ranges. The shop in my area quoted me $400 installed for true duals with an h pipe, magnaflow/flowmaster muffler, and chrome tips coming out any way I want. What do ya think?

The biggest factor in install costs is the area you live in. There's a shop near me that did my complete install for only $160 in labor. Jeff even drove up here to have his done.


Depending on the shop you go to, it is usually cheapest to buy your parts separate (mufflers, crossover, cats, etc) and have the shop do the install. The $160 that my shop charged was for install of new pipe all the way through, as well.

I spent $155 on cats and mufflers, and then $100 a side to have it done in ss, including labor. So $355 for all of it. Depends on the shop. Most definitely do not buy your parts at the shop, its much cheaper to buy off summit or ebay or whatever.
